#1 9 years ago

So....does RFM not have a wizard mode? I completed all levels tonight and it just started back at the same. Guess I thought there might be a final boss or something? I'm running v1.1.

#2 9 years ago

You need to have all the saucer lights lit in the center of the pf.

#3 9 years ago

You are awarded a saucer light for finishing a mode perfectly. You can earn saucer lights other ways as well. All 9(?) saucer lights lit + all modes completed = Attack Mars!

#4 9 years ago

Sweet! Thanks guys

#5 9 years ago
Quoted from Pinstym:

You are awarded a saucer light for finishing a mode perfectly. You can earn saucer lights other ways as well. All 9(?) saucer lights lit + all modes completed = Attack Mars!

Other ways to get lights include super jackpots during multiball, collecting enough items during Bonus Wave multiball, etc. visit papa.org for extensive rule sheets.

The RFM wizard mode is quite unique, requiring you to use the auxiliary buttons to move video targets over the physical shot you are aiming at. Good stuff.

Whoa! I am a recent owner and would love more clarity on those flipper aux buttons. What else are they used for besides just selecting the mode to start on?
Thanks much!!

#7 9 years ago
Quoted from MAJRob:

Whoa! I am a recent owner and would love more clarity on those flipper aux buttons. What else are they used for besides just selecting the mode to start on?
Thanks much!!

You can use them to move the shot multiplier. Multiplier shot usually starts on a ramp shot, move it to the center for an easier multiplied shot. I believe the regular buttons also move the multiplier, but not as fast as the outside buttons.

Go get some better scores. d

During multiball, the middle jackpots are the easiest to collect. Get the multiplier to the middle, then look back at the display again when things slow down to move it back again.

You can also use the auxiliary buttons on the abduction mode to Chang ether vehicle being takin. Different vehicles are worth more points .
